About the Role
The Kitchen Shift Manager supports the kitchen manager and pub manager, ensuring the smooth running of kitchen operations. This role involves leading and motivating the team to meet sales, profit, and compliance targets, while delivering exceptional customer service and operational excellence.
Key Responsibilities
-
Daily Operations: Run shifts unsupervised to achieve:
- Outstanding customer service
- On-time food delivery with correct specifications
- Strict adherence to Wetherspoon standard operating procedures (SOPs) and company policies, ensuring a clean, safe, and legal workspace
-
Leadership & Motivation: Support, guide, and inspire the team to maintain high standards in food quality, productivity, and compliance.
-
Financial & Commercial Responsibility:
- Achieve daily sales and financial targets.
- Take proactive steps to increase sales while controlling costs.
- Work closely with the kitchen manager to:
- Forecast sales and costs
- Manage the profit and loss account
- Identify and maximise sales opportunities
-
Multi-Tasking & Problem-Solving: Prioritise duties, delegate effectively, and resolve operational challenges.
-
Compliance & Standards:
- Ensuring cleanliness, product quality, customer service, and maintenance meet company expectations.
- Adhering to legislative requirements and company policies.
- Managing cash handling (once trained).
